About the job

Affirm is reinventing credit to make it more honest and friendly, giving consumers the flexibility to buy now and pay later without hidden fees or compounding interest. The Batch Infra team provides reliable, scalable, self-serve compute solutions for ML, Product, and Financial Engineering.

What you'll do

  • Own and deliver quarterly goals, lead engineers through ambiguity, and ensure support throughout delivery.
  • Collaborate with product management, design, and analytics on technical constraints and trade-offs.
  • Identify and solve project, process, technology, or business issues.
  • Support operations and availability of team artifacts, including metrics and on-call efforts.
  • Foster a culture of quality and ownership through code review and design standards.
  • Develop talent by providing feedback and guidance.

What we look for

  • 4+ years designing, developing, and launching backend systems at scale using Python or Kotlin.
  • Experience with highly available distributed systems using AWS, MySQL, and Kubernetes.
  • Experience with workflow orchestration frameworks like Airflow, Flyte, Prefect, Temporal, Luigi.
  • Experience scaling frameworks like Spark/Flink for large-scale datasets on Kubernetes.
  • Ability to define technical plans for significant features with elegant, simple, extensible design.
  • Strong communication skills for global collaboration.

Compensation & Benefits

Base pay range: $153,000 - $213,000 CAD. Total compensation may include equity rewards, monthly stipends for health, wellness, and tech spending, and benefits including 100% subsidized medical, dental, and vision coverage for you and dependents. Also includes flexible spending wallets, time off, and ESPP.
